Problem
The widespread use of single-use plastic packaging contributes significantly to environmental pollution and resource depletion. Traditional fiber molding techniques for sustainable packaging alternatives often require substantial water and energy consumption, limiting their overall environmental benefit and scalability.
Solution
BIO-LUTIONS provides sustainable packaging solutions made from agricultural residues using a proprietary dry molding technology. This process significantly reduces water and energy consumption compared to conventional fiber molding, resulting in a lower environmental footprint. The resulting fiber-based packaging is fully recyclable, food-safe, robust, and odor-neutral, offering a viable alternative to single-use plastics. BIO-LUTIONS enables businesses to reduce plastic waste and meet increasing market demand for environmentally responsible packaging.

Features
- Dry molding production technology for efficient manufacturing
- Fiber-based packaging made from agricultural residues
- Recyclable (CEPI certified) and compostable materials
- Food-safe and odor-neutral properties
- High-performance alternative to single-use plastic
- Reduced water and energy consumption compared to traditional fiber molding
- Customizable for various packaging applications, including trays, injection molding, and blown containers
